引言
基因编辑技术,作为一种革命性的生物技术,正在逐渐改变我们对生命科学的理解。近年来,随着CRISPR-Cas9等基因编辑工具的问世,科学家们能够在成人的细胞中精确地修改基因,从而为治疗遗传疾病、延缓衰老甚至改善人类基因组本身提供了可能。本文将深入探讨基因编辑技术的原理、应用前景以及面临的伦理挑战。
基因编辑技术原理
1. CRISPR-Cas9系统
CRISPR-Cas9是一种基于细菌天然防御机制的基因编辑工具。它包括Cas9蛋白和一段与目标DNA序列互补的RNA(sgRNA)。当Cas9蛋白与sgRNA结合后,会识别并切割目标DNA序列。随后,细胞自身的DNA修复机制会介入,通过非同源末端连接(NHEJ)或同源臂替换(HDR)来修复切割的DNA。
代码示例:CRISPR-Cas9靶点设计
def design_crispr_target(dna_sequence, target_sequence):
"""
设计CRISPR-Cas9的靶点序列。
:param dna_sequence: 全长DNA序列
:param target_sequence: 目标序列
:return: CRISPR靶点序列和sgRNA序列
"""
# 找到目标序列在DNA中的位置
target_position = dna_sequence.find(target_sequence)
# 设计sgRNA序列
sgRNA_sequence = target_sequence[0:20] + "NGG" # 假设目标序列长度超过20个碱基
return sgRNA_sequence, target_position
# 示例
dna_sequence = "ATCGTACGATCGTACG"
target_sequence = "GATCG"
sgRNA_sequence, target_position = design_crispr_target(dna_sequence, target_sequence)
print("sgRNA序列:", sgRNA_sequence)
print("目标位置:", target_position)
2. 其他基因编辑工具
除了CRISPR-Cas9,还有其他基因编辑工具,如TALENs(Transcription Activator-Like Effector Nucleases)和ZFNs(Zinc-Finger Nucleases)。这些工具与CRISPR-Cas9类似,但靶点设计更为复杂。
基因编辑的应用前景
1. 治疗遗传疾病
基因编辑技术有望治疗许多遗传性疾病,如囊性纤维化、血友病和杜氏肌营养不良症等。通过编辑患者的基因,可以纠正导致疾病的基因突变。
2. 延缓衰老
基因编辑可能有助于延缓衰老过程,通过修复与衰老相关的基因缺陷来延长寿命。
3. 改善人类基因组
基因编辑技术可能用于改善人类基因组,如提高智力、增强免疫力或消除某些遗传疾病的风险。
伦理挑战
尽管基因编辑技术具有巨大的潜力,但也面临着诸多伦理挑战:
1. 伦理争议
基因编辑可能引发关于人类本质、遗传平等和社会正义的伦理争议。
2. 安全性问题
基因编辑可能导致不可预测的副作用,如基因突变或免疫系统破坏。
3. 不平等问题
基因编辑技术可能加剧社会不平等,只有富裕人群才能负担得起这种治疗。
结论
基因编辑技术正在开启一个全新的生命科学时代。尽管存在伦理和安全挑战,但这一技术的潜力巨大,有望为人类带来前所未有的健康和福祉。随着研究的深入和技术的进步,我们期待看到基因编辑技术在未来的广泛应用。
